Output 6873497bdcf2fc58a9b547978f2a23f4c420505345ac6eb1b18fbdd67f626634:2

value
100059
script pubkey
OP_0 OP_PUSHBYTES_20 d570fb91a377c5842aaa2eca14a241de3ba8bc28
address
bc1q64c0hydrwlzcg2429m9pfgjpmca630pgjfg44g
transaction
6873497bdcf2fc58a9b547978f2a23f4c420505345ac6eb1b18fbdd67f626634
spent
true